Rupee falls 7 paise to close at 86.71 against US dollar
Mumbai, Feb 21 (PTI) The rupee pared initial gains and settled 7 paise lower at 86.71 (provisional) against the U.S. dollar on Friday (February 21, 2025), weighed down by sustained foreign fund outflows and a recovery in the American currency index. Forex traders said the Indian rupee declined on Friday (February 21, 2025) on weak domestic markets and a recovery in the U.S. dollar index. However, weak crude oil prices cushioned the downside.
